Comparison of cognitive function among different groups of CHIPS score
Variables | Group 1 | Group 2 | Group 3 | P value |
CHIPS≤4 (n=213) | 5≤CHIPS≤15 (n=113) | CHIPS≥16 (n=138) | ||
Sex (M/%) | 101/47.4 | 51/45.1 | 78/56.5 | 0.318 |
Age | 64.1±4.8 | 65.8±4.5 | 64.7±5.1 | 0.615 |
CHIPS score | 0.7±0.8 | 9.9±3.4* | 34.7±19.2*† | <0.0001 |
Total WMH volume | 527.4±1738.6 | 1327.5±2871.5* | 4005.1±4121.2*† | <0.0001 |
WMH volume in cholinergic pathway | 93.3±336.1 | 178.5±509.2* | 751.8±1005.6*† | <0.0001 |
MMSE | 26.1±3.7 | 25.3±3.9* | 24.2±4.1*† | 0.019 |
MoCA | 21.8±5.7 | 19.8±5.2 | 18.9±4.9*† | 0.015 |
Executive function (TMT) | 0.10 (−0.51 to 0.70) | −0.02 (−0.80 to 0.65) | −0.09 (−0.85 to 0.52)*† | 0.029 |
Short-term memory (AVLT) | 0.22 (−0.64 to 1.03) | −0.03 (−0.79 to 0.86) | −0.08 (−0.76 to 0.50) | 0.539 |
Long-term memory (AVLT) | −0.11 (−0.51 to 0.69) | 0.06 (−0.68 to 0.81) | −0.23 (−0.65 to 0.61) | 0.616 |
Attention (SDMT) | −0.09 (−0.56 to 0.47) | −0.15 (−0.74 to 0.34)* | −0.17 (−0.94 to 0.05)*† | 0.016 |
Language (VFT) | 0.70 (−0.81 to 0.45) | −0.01 (−0.72 to 0.44) | 0.01 (−0.81 to 0.69) | 0.332 |
Definition of abbreviations: One-way analysis of variance was used in analyses for the parameters among three groups and an independent sample t-test was used in analysis between two groups. P<0.05 is bolded.
Score of TMT, AVLT, SDMT and VFT were present as standard z-score (median, quartile).
*P value<0.05 versus Group I.
†P value<0.05 versus Group II.
AVLT, Auditory Verbal Learning Test; CHIPS, Cholinergic Pathways Hyperintensities Scale; MMSE, Mini-Mental State Examination; MoCA, Montreal Cognitive Assessment; SDMT, Symbol Digit Modality Test; TMT, Trail Making Test; VFT, Verbal Fluency Test; WMH, white matter hyperintensities.
